View full abstract and other project information on NIH RePORTER Go To NIH RePORTER Excerpt: Background: Evidence from VA and non-VA settings demonstrates widespread racial disparities in healthcare delivery. Our prior work suggests that providers with higher levels of “cultural competence” (CC) deliver more equitable care. But how CC translates into better care is unclear. We will use data from our current project, “Opening the Black Box of Cultural Competence” (aka Black Box), in which we are analyzing communication content from audio recorded primary care visits.
